Even if you don't like cabbage you should try this. 1 -2 lb ground beef 1 small onion, chopped 1 medium head of cabbage, chopped 1 (10 ounce) can Ro-tel 1/2 lb Velveeta, cubed 1 teaspoon salt 1 teaspoon black pepper 1 teaspoon garlic powder In a large skillet, brown beef with chopped onion. Drain, if necessary. Return meat mixture to pan. Add chopped cabbage (this may have to be done in batches depending on how big of a pan you use). Cook until cabbage is somewhat wilted. Add Rotel and continue to cook until cabbage is tender. Add cubed Velveeta and seasonings to taste. Cook until cheese is melted. Serve hot.

Cherries or peaches can be substituted for apples. 1 (21 ounce) can apple pie filling 6 (8 inch) flour tortillas 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on 1/2 cup butter 1/2 cup white sugar 1/2 cup brown sugar 1/2 cup water Spoon about one heaping quarter cup of pie filling evenly down the center of each tortilla. Sprinkle with cinnamon; roll up, tucking in edges; and place seam side down in prepared dish. In a medium saucepan over medium heat, combine butter, white sugar, brown sugar and water. Bring to a boil, stirring constantly; reduce heat and simmer 3 minutes. Pour sauce over enchiladas and let stand 45 minutes. Bake in preheated oven 20 minutes, or until golden. Serve with vanilla ice cream.
Short on cornmeal? Grinding up extra popping corn is an easy and frugal way to create cornmeal that tastes fresh and delicious. Of courses, if you have medium grind cornmeal, you need not grind popcorn!

Corn, or maize in British English, originated in South America and spread around the globe. In addition to fresh corn cobs, corn by-products like corn flour and corn starch are widely used, and dent corn or field corn provides grain to livestock worldwide. #corn #growing
